The Miseducation of the Negro by Carter G. Woodson-Chapter 18 (of 18)
15m · Published
The Study of the Negro...The oppressor...teaches the Negro he has no worthwhile past,that his race has done nothing significant since the beginning of time...lead the Negro to believe this and thus control his thinking. If you can thereby determine what he will think, you will not need to worry about what he will do...the oppressor, then, may conquer, exploit, oppress and even annihilate the Negro...without fear or trembling... --- Send in a voice message: https://anchor.fm/blisb/message Support this podcast: https://anchor.fm/blisb/support

The Miseducation of the Negro by Carter G.Woodson-Chapter 15 (of 18)
30m · Published
Vocational Guidance-Negroes do not need some one to guide them to what persons of another race have developed. They must be taught to think and develop something for themselves....The Negro, as a slave, developed this fatal sort of dependency; and, restricted to menial service and drudgery during nominal freedom , he has not grown out of it. Now the Negro is facing the ordeal of either learning to do for himself or to die out gradually in the bread line in the ghetto. --- Send in a voice message: https://anchor.fm/blisb/message Support this podcast: https://anchor.fm/blisb/support

The Miseducation of the Negro by Carter G. Woodson-Chapter 13 (of 18)
19m · Published
Understand the Negro... such has been the education of Negroes. They have been taught ‘facts’ of history but have never learned to think. Their conception is that you go to school to find out what other people have done, and then you go out in life and imitate them... --- Send in a voice message: https://anchor.fm/blisb/message Support this podcast: https://anchor.fm/blisb/support
